Dirty Clothes

Sarah’s laundry clothes were murmuring in a faint rustle. Oh, yes! you heard me right. Sarah’s clothes always used to debate what kind of person she is.

Her crisp formal wear said in a gallant voice “oh I know for sure Sarah is a brilliant professional woman, the other day I accompanied her to office and the way she works with everyone and gets the work done makes that evident. “

Her sports jersey also acknowledged that she is a fierce sportswoman. It told in a sing song voice “you should see Sarah in volleyball court she never misses to strike her ball into her opponent court. Though I turn out muddier” he added disgruntled ” I still enjoy the game with her.”

“Ahem Ahem “

Every cloth turned to see who it was.

It was the apron’s irritated grunt. It began in shrill tone “oh! hell with that woman! I don’t know why she uses all the spices stacked in the kitchen. More over every time she lets the stew boil vigorously, I get stained and burnt.” It ended in rather sorrow tone “I would really wish she not being clumsy in the kitchen that would really benefit me get rid of this foul smell of dried spices and smudges of curry “.

Sarah’s nightdress now positively joined with apron to voice its disapproval about Sarah. “I too really wish she doesn’t roll over too much in bed. she makes me all wrinkled within minutes”

Now every cloth turned to the fancy dress of Sarah’s and asked in dismay about its opinion on Sarah.

Fancy dress was too nonchalant. It rather added in a very bored voice “I go out with Sarah very occasionally to very exquisite places where she mostly dines and meets people. But you see as I am an occasional wear to elite places unlike you folks, I am treated much elegantly than you “saying this in a hearty tone it resigned to its corner.

The other clothes were completely irritated and humiliated by its response. So, they all started to yell out at the fancy dress for belittling them.

Suddenly there was a splash of laundry detergent on top of them. They all were momentarily startled by the incoming downpour.

The detergent gave a rueful smile and said “Tut, Tut, Tut the same discussion over and over again. Stop judging people you will get no good out of it. Come on! let’s all take a good hot shower and I will clean you inside out and wipe out your memories.”
